реклама на сайте
подробности

 
 
 
Reply to this topicStart new topic
> Помогите с LVDS в крякусе
Kluwert
сообщение Nov 22 2011, 10:49
Сообщение #1


Местный
***

Группа: Участник
Сообщений: 239
Регистрация: 15-11-09
Из: Санкт-Петербург
Пользователь №: 53 639



Люди, помогите, заколебался уже. Ранее никогда с LVDS не работал. Принесли отладку с Stratix IVGX, там управляемый генератор с LVDS-выходом. Перечитал уже, наверное, весь сайт Alterы. Мне нужно просто втащить эту частоту в камень как тактовую. Нет у меня никаких данных, не нужен мне ALTLVDS. Пытался даже на ALTPLL, но она не понимает разностных входов. Короче, два дня уже угробил! Помогите убогому sm.gif
Go to the top of the page
 
+Quote Post
sazh
сообщение Nov 22 2011, 12:21
Сообщение #2


Гуру
******

Группа: Свой
Сообщений: 2 435
Регистрация: 6-10-04
Из: Петербург
Пользователь №: 804



Цитата(Kluwert @ Nov 22 2011, 13:49) *
Мне нужно просто втащить эту частоту в камень как тактовую.



В проекте он как одиночный на ту же pll
Задаете его в пин планере на специализированный вход (p) как lvds.
Если кристалл этот пин как lvds поддерживает, пин планер сам вставит пин, на который должен приходить (n) генератора
Go to the top of the page
 
+Quote Post
Kluwert
сообщение Nov 22 2011, 13:18
Сообщение #3


Местный
***

Группа: Участник
Сообщений: 239
Регистрация: 15-11-09
Из: Санкт-Петербург
Пользователь №: 53 639



Цитата(sazh @ Nov 22 2011, 15:21) *
Если кристалл этот пин как lvds поддерживает, пин планер сам вставит пин, на который должен приходить (n) генератора


Не, это все сделано. Вопрос в том, как его в схему (главный файл проекта - графический .bdf, ну привык я так). Подключаю его к функции ALTIOBUF, устанвливаю diff mode, он говорит типа хочу обычные выводы, не разностные. Использую примитив alt_io_buf, тот же эффект. Примитив alt_io_buf_diff не поддерживается для stratix'а IV. Короче, вроде совсем простая задачу, а нигде ответа найти не могу.
Go to the top of the page
 
+Quote Post
Alex11
сообщение Nov 22 2011, 13:25
Сообщение #4


Гуру
******

Группа: Свой
Сообщений: 2 106
Регистрация: 23-10-04
Из: С-Петербург
Пользователь №: 965



Да не нужно там никаких функций, обычный In, а затем все что сказано выше.
Go to the top of the page
 
+Quote Post
sazh
сообщение Nov 22 2011, 13:43
Сообщение #5


Гуру
******

Группа: Свой
Сообщений: 2 435
Регистрация: 6-10-04
Из: Петербург
Пользователь №: 804



Цитата(Kluwert @ Nov 22 2011, 16:18) *
как его в схему главный файл проекта - графический .bdf, ну привык я так


прогоняете проект при входном тактовом (например input f_40 по умолчанию что в квартусе стоит).
он в пин планере появится. Присвоите ему пин (p) и статус lvds. Все.
И снова прогоните.
Go to the top of the page
 
+Quote Post
stu
сообщение Sep 5 2012, 10:13
Сообщение #6


Местный
***

Группа: Свой
Сообщений: 235
Регистрация: 11-11-09
Пользователь №: 53 561



Здравствуйте, ув. форумчане!
Подскажите, пжлст, как из LVDS-сигнала вытащить опорную частоту малой кровью?
Находил в форуме, что можно отдельную микруху ставить, которая будет выделять clock. Видел давно, сейчас не помню, что и куда...
Хотел обсудить возможность реализовать это внутри ПЛИС. Если у кого-нить есть догадки или может даже реализация, буду признателен.

Есть идея, поставить фильтр низких частот и усилитель снаружи... Но внутри никак????

Сообщение отредактировал stu - Sep 5 2012, 11:35


--------------------
Мы ведь работаем, чтобы жить, а не живем, чтобы работать??? ;)
Go to the top of the page
 
+Quote Post

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 18th July 2025 - 09:42
Рейтинг@Mail.ru


Страница сгенерированна за 0.01364 секунд с 7
ELECTRONIX ©2004-2016